程序師世界是廣大編程愛好者互助、分享、學習的平台,程序師世界有你更精彩!
首頁
編程語言
C語言|JAVA編程
Python編程
網頁編程
ASP編程|PHP編程
JSP編程
數據庫知識
MYSQL數據庫|SqlServer數據庫
Oracle數據庫|DB2數據庫
您现在的位置: 程式師世界 >> 編程語言 >  >> 更多編程語言 >> Python

Python執行多行cmd

編輯:Python

Python執行多行cmd的小細節

import os
cmd = "cd ~/ & ls"
os.system(cmd)

當多個命令之間用一個&連接的時候,實際上是單獨運行的,也就是在cd到根目錄之後退出,然後在運行該文件的路徑下再運行ls查看當前路徑下的目錄。運行結果如下:

import os
cmd = "cd ~/ && ls"
os.system(cmd)

如果多條命令之間用兩個&&進行連接的話,則運行的結果就是先cd到根目錄下,然後在這個基礎上查看當前目錄的文件,結果如下所示:


  1. 上一篇文章:
  2. 下一篇文章:
Copyright © 程式師世界 All Rights Reserved